安卓系统签名绕过:深入探讨操作系统安全技术188

在安卓操作系统中,系统签名是一个重要的安全机制,它旨在确保设备上运行的所有应用程序都是由受信任的来源签名。然而,对于有经验的黑客或安全研究人员来说,绕过系统签名并非不可能。本文将深入探讨安卓系统签名绕过技术,分析其影响并提供缓解措施。

安卓系统签名概述

安卓系统签名由多个机制组成,包括:

* 代码签名:所有安卓应用程序都必须使用谷歌的公钥进行签名,以验证其完整性和合法性。* 引导加载程序签名:引导加载程序是设备启动时加载的操作系统内核。它也必须由谷歌签名。* 内核签名:内核是操作系统的核心,它也必须由谷歌签名。* 用户空间签名:用户空间组件,如应用程序和库,必须由其相应的签名者签名。

安卓系统签名绕过技术

绕过安卓系统签名的方法有几种,包括:

* 攻击引导加载程序:攻击引导加载程序可以允许黑客重新签名内核或安装未签名的自定义恢复模式。* 内核漏洞利用:利用内核漏洞可以允许黑客提升权限并在系统上运行未签名的代码。* 基于ROM的漏洞:某些自定义安卓ROM包含允许系统签名绕过的漏洞。* 反射调用:黑客可以使用反射调用技术在运行时修改应用程序的行为,包括绕过安全检查。* 社会工程:黑客可能会诱骗用户安装未签名的应用程序或授予恶意应用程序特权。

系统签名绕过的影响

绕过系统签名具有严重的影响,包括:

* 未授权的应用程序安装:黑客可以在设备上安装未签名的恶意应用程序,窃取敏感数据或控制设备。* 系统完整性受损:绕过系统签名会破坏操作系统的完整性,使其更容易受到攻击。* 数据泄露:恶意应用程序可以访问设备上的敏感数据,如密码、财务信息和个人信息。* 设备控制:黑客可能会获得对设备的完全控制,包括访问摄像头、麦克风和位置服务。

缓解措施

为了缓解安卓系统签名绕过的风险,用户可以采取以下措施:

* 仅从受信任的来源安装应用程序:从谷歌Play商店或其他信誉良好的应用商店安装应用程序。* 小心可疑链接和电子邮件:避免点击来自未知来源的链接或打开可疑电子邮件的附件。* 定期更新设备:安全更新会修复漏洞并加强设备安全性。* 使用反病毒软件:反病毒软件可以检测并阻止恶意应用程序。* 启用双因素身份验证:启用双因素身份验证以防止黑客访问您的帐户。

安卓系统签名绕过是一个严重的安全威胁,可能会导致未授权的应用程序安装、系统完整性受损和数据泄露。通过理解绕过技术、评估其影响并实施适当的缓解措施,用户可以保护他们的设备免受这些风险的影响。保持软件更新、注意网络安全惯例并使用可靠的安全工具对于确保安卓设备的安全至关重要。

2024-11-07


上一篇:macOS 系统音乐制作指南:发掘演奏、录音和编曲的强大功能

下一篇:华为鸿蒙系统:迈向自主之路